What if there's another way? What if it's not actually about behavior at all? Join Dr. Mona Delahooke, licensed clinical psychologist and expert in neurodevelopmental interventions for children with developmental, behavioral, emotional, and learning differences, for this compelling session that will fundamentally shift your view of oppositional behavior in children and adolescents. Dr. Delahooke seamlessly weaves together neuroscience with real-life, common scenarios by offering a practical roadmap to help transform your response to behavior problems. You'll learn: The missing piece to understanding behavior: Neuroception Why behavior contracts and incentives fail to yield long-term success How to discern between intentional behavior and stress responses "Bottom-up" interventions you can use right away And more!
